Jdc High School
School Overview
Jdc High School is a public school located in Bassfield, Mississippi. It is a school in Jefferson Davis County School District district.
According to the Mississippi state assessment result, about 27% of students are proficient in Math learning and about 17%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.
It has 402 students through grade 9 to 12. The students to teacher ratio is 14 to 1 where a total of 28 teachers are teaching for the school.
Student Population
A total of 402 students are attending Jdc High School. By gender, there are 210 and 192 female students at the school.
Teachers & Staffs
Total 28 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Jdc High School and the students to teacher ratio is 14 to 1. All teachers are certified. 89.3%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
